Writ Petition fil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ying to issue a Writ of Mandamus directing the first respondent to dispose of the appeal filed by the petitioner dated 13.02.2018 as against the order passed by the Tahsildar, Sankarapuram Taluk vide Order Number 111/1416 dated 16.03.2007 within the stipulated time.

Mr.E.Balamurugan, learned Special Government Pleader takes notice for the respondent. Since this writ petition is being disposed of, without affecting the interest of the second respondent, notice to the said respondent is dispensed with.

2. The petitioner seeks for a mandamus directing the first respondent to dispose of the appeal dated 13.02.2018 filed as against the order passed by the Tahsildar, Sankarapuram Taluk, dated 16.03.2007, arising out of patta proceedings.

3. Heard both sides.

4. The grievance of the petitioner before this Court is that the said appeal has not been disposed of by the first respondent so far.

5. This Court, at this stage, is not expressing any view on the merits of the claim made by the petitioner, as it is for the first respondent to consider and decide the same and pass https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/

appropriate orders on merits and in accordance with law. Accordingly, this writ petition is disposed of, only by directing the first respondent to dispose of the appeal dated 13.02.2018 and pass orders on the same on merits and in accordance with law, after hearing the petitioner, the second respondent and the other interested parties, if any. Such exercise shall be done by the first respondent within a period of eight we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order. No costs.
